    Feeding Question
    I am wondering which is more nutritious to my year '10 Ball Pythons, an adult mouse or rat pup. I know in adult form the rat can offer more nutrition, however I'm not sure in the rat pup vs. adult mouse contrast.
  • 12-25-2010, 06:26 PM
    Subdriven
    I'd go rat pup.. that way you have them already on rats and no issues later. If they are the same size the rat willl be better.
